Everyday we dedicate ourselves to our J. O. B. As widespread, diverse and variant the independent aspects of our daily routine may be, we all share the same bottom line - we work. We work hard, work long, work smart, and constantly strive to better either ourselves as individuals, our dedicated profession(s), or the company we consider worthy of the majority of our time (and ultimately our lives). Some (probably the majority) say its for a little piece of paper, thats right - a paycheck. But im not confident that is the sole purpose of 'work'. I think its more than that. I believe that it is to better something. Thats the whole point, right? To obtain a higher meaning of success or fulfillment. We, as humans, on a basic emotional level, have needs - and I believe one elemental desire is cored around 'contribution'. To add, give, and/or provide significance to the said 'something' in which we love.
Now, here's the challenge... we have to find and embrace those certain individuals who appreciate and share the passion - the hunger. (whether its family, friends, employees, or a city). Everyday is a journey, a hunt, a pursuit. We all are searching for the same (or similar at least) thing -meaning. Something to engrave a small yet lasting mark on this unbelievably overwhelming world. It's in the moment that you discover a purpose in your work that you truly see the potential of what you are doing. The 'why' becomes clear and you will become more focused than ever.
Once attained, an accomplished level of acceptance, respect, or shared commitment cant be expressed by a monetary value. Its simply not possible because the emotional rewards of work, the ones that completely overwhelm you with insights of clarity, particularly pertaining to the purpose of your dedication, are absolutely invaluable. When your head hits the pillow at night after an exhausting 13 hour day of strenuous labor and you are still smiling because people, companies, communities, and/or professions are bettered by your achievements, outreach and dedication, then you will understand that your need is being met. In this moment you realize that you cant put a price on meaning...
